Speakers urge council to act on homelessness: Safe-spot proposal and better-managed camps urged after nearby shooting
Summary
Multiple public commenters urged the council to adopt North State Shelter Team's "safe spot" tiny-home proposal and to take stronger action on a persistent homeless encampment after a nearby shooting; speakers also called for better maintenance of sidewalks and trees.
A string of public commenters urged the Chico City Council to take stronger, immediate action on homelessness, including support for a proposal from North State Shelter Team to place tiny homes on church parking lots and to establish supervised "safe spot" communities.
Charles (last name not specified) said North State Shelter Team had two proposals on the city desk and that one proposal would cost the city "virtually nothing"…
